Paintings during this period were truly a labor of love. Artists used natural water-based inks and pigments. The black ink came from lampblack, a substance made by burning pine resins or tung oil; colored pigments are derived from vegetable and mineral materials. Both were manufactured by mixing the pigment source with a glue base, which is then pressed into cake or stick form; using special stones and tools, the artist ground the ink back into a watery solution immediately before painting. The brushes used for painting were similar to those used for calligraphy, but there is greater variety in the shapes and resilience of brushes used. Traditionally two different types of painting surfaces were used:, silk and paper. Both require sizing, or treatment with a glue-like substance on their uppermost surface, to prevent ink and pigment from soaking into and being completely absorbed by the ground. This piece was created with silk. Applying paint to a silk surface requires more painstaking techniques, building up ink and colors carefully and gradually in layers. This artwork was originally brought into existence as a hanging scroll. Hanging scroll displays show off entire, large paintings scenes all at once and typically range in height from two to six feet. The earliest hanging scrolls may be related developmentally to tomb banners, which are known from the early Han dynasty. Hanging scrolls came to be used with greater regularity from the tenth century onward. Traditionally, fine Chinese paintings were only taken out and viewed on special occasions, which serves to preserve their condition. They were kept in storage when not in use.
